S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: 
    Title: Annual Wildfire Summary Report.
    OMB Number: 0596-0025.
    Expiration Date of Approval: August 31, 2016.
    Type of Request: Extension of a currently approved collection.
    Abstract: The Cooperative Forestry Assistance Act of 1978 (16 
U.S.C. 2101 (note) Sec. 10) requires the Forest Service to collect 
information about wildfire suppression efforts by State and local 
firefighting agencies in support of congressional funding requests for 
the

[[Page 42309]]

Forest Service State and Private Forestry Cooperative Fire Program. The 
program provides supplemental funding for State and local firefighting 
agencies. The Forest Service works cooperatively with State and local 
firefighting agencies to support their fire suppression efforts.
    State fire marshals and State forestry officials use form FS-3100-8 
(Annual Wildfire Summary Report) to report information to the Forest 
Service regarding State and local wildfire suppression efforts. The 
Forest Service is unable to assess the effectiveness of the State and 
Private Forestry Cooperative Fire Program without this information. 
Forest Service managers evaluate the information to determine if the 
Cooperative Fire Program funds used by State and local fire agencies 
have improved fire suppression capabilities. The Forest Service shares 
the information with Congress as part of the annual request for funding 
for this program.
    The information collected includes the number of fires responded to 
by State or local firefighting agencies within a fiscal year, as well 
as the following information pertaining to such fires:
     Fire type (timber, structural, or grassland);
     Size (in acres) of the fires;
     Cause of fires (lightning, campfires, arson, etc.); and
     Suppression costs associated with the fires.
    The data gathered is not available from any other sources.
    Estimate of Burden per Response: 30 minutes.
    Type of Respondents: State fire marshals or State forestry 
officials.
    Estimated Annual Number of Respondents: 56.
    Estimated Annual Number of Responses per Respondent: 1.
    Estimated Total Annual Burden on Respondents: 28 hours.
